Type
ORACLE
Validation date
2025-10-15 01:33: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 3.6769e-4,
    "usd": 4.2672e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001245EE7DDD18D3520AF82D77872EF92EF897DC60AF3A7D350227720A6793511CC

Previous signature

8FE8DFB242FFF5932657156164ECEC205251C2F5E238DC26D52EE5B0642446641E3704E51F21DF4BD9ED977E783477F3974A7A0F1A9A172A25A020E33C7DAE0A

Origin signature

3045022100ABE3B644AABF2ED65165B106BD944BD0369A4C6FAEF2FF4A70B37A7A41AC57F802201D616390BDD53D14D06274BA98754E9314C7046418542D3B190C377696D99655

Proof of work

010104D9E5DAA1DF6B93211DDD778A8C4A71E2D39DE09E74F44645C7CDD40CF9E236ED52D7942E9B6435F4BDCF6413385AB8111ADA80A33DBE310BD5B7B332836874F9

Proof of integrity

0075A19DC385146B6697E3953E852F4586922650D3EBF8CF7E3668439E2E997C60

Coordinator signature

8ED99EC7F3936BAE666FBCBD50C7A4E00C45DB29867ECFAD23502EFE271BEDC49D63AE8B6C4EE46C1F63CA276FFA5D6B238EFAA00101B35B1A949B66ECB4100A

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

E5B7DD548D8C7B5ABEE7A39E05983EE25D91490356F5768F05C0371A8EB0B50B20557CF910381DDFB5A1F70DE150F283CFC6A2AE4074F03027B739B38D15D80D

Validator #2 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#2 signature

5FFFA4B38511224199C88525B9AFED81D525E7EDE3094AA492A3FDA5BBB80CD71B2D2FF96C364548B05353E4E163F57A469DE4F6370C030C06BF5E002D3B430F